A conditional use permit may be revokable, may be granted for a limited time, <br />or may be granted subject to such conditions as the Council may prescribe. <br />C. A conditional use permit shall remain in effect as long as the conditions agreed <br />upon are observed, but nothing in this Section shall prevent the City from enacting or amending <br />official controls to change the status of conditional uses. <br />D. A certified copy of any conditional use permit shall be filed with the County <br />Recorder or Registrar of Titles of the county or counties in which the City is located for record. The <br />conditional use permit shall include the legal description of the property included. <br />Source: City Code <br />Effective Date: 4-1-84 <br />Subd. 7. Conditional Uses: Denial of Permit. The Council shall set forth <br />contemporaneously in writing and in detail all the reasons for the denial of the conditional use permit <br />application. No application for a conditional use permit which has been denied wholly or in part <br />shall be resubmitted for a period of six months from the date of said denial, except on grounds of <br />new evidence or proof of changes of conditions found to be valid by the Planning Commission. <br />Source: Ordinance No. 172 <br />Effective Date: 1-1-75 <br />Subd. 8. Conditional Uses: Lapse of Permit. A conditional use permit shall lapse <br />one year following the date on which it became effective, unless prior to that time a building permit <br />is issued by the Building Inspector and construction is commenced and pursued toward completion <br />on the site which was the subject of the conditional use permit application. A conditional use permit <br />may be renewed for an additional period of one year provided that the request be filed prior to the <br />expiration of one year from the date when the use permit is filed with the Zoning Administrator. The <br />Council may grant or deny an application for renewal of a conditional use permit. <br />Subd. 9. Conditional Uses: Lapse of Use.
